Fund Summary

The fund invests in income-producing fixed income and alternative strategy exchange-traded funds ("ETFs"). Fixed income ETFs may invest in non-investment grade fixed income securities, commonly known as "high yield" or "junk" bonds that are rated below Baa3 by Moody's Investors Service or similarly by another rating agency. It may also invest in ETFs that primarily invest in dividend-paying equity securities of U.S., foreign and emerging market issuers.
